Infinity Lithium Corporation is an Australian listed minerals company that is seeking to develop it’s 75% owned San Jose Lithium Project and produce battery grade lithium hydroxide in Spain. Supply response is needed to satisfy Europe’s burgeoning energy storage needs through feeding the large-scale battery plants currently under construction.

The San Jose deposit is a highly advanced, previously mined brownfield development opportunity representing EU’s second largest lithium deposit. Infinity Lithium will mine the hard rock Mica resource and develop processing facilities to provide a long term, low cost, and sustainable European mine-to-end-product lithium hydroxide operation.
